Responsibilities of the Quantity Surveyor:

  • Prepare, submit, and negotiate interim valuations and applications for payment.
  • Monitor project costs, budgets, forecasts, and cash flow.
  • Produce accurate cost value reconciliations (CVRs) on a monthly basis.
  • Identify commercial risks and implement mitigation strategies.
  • Manage project variations, change control processes, and compensation events.
  • Prepare and agree final accounts with clients and main contractors.
  • Review and administer contracts including JCT forms and bespoke subcontract agreements.
  • Ensure contractual compliance and protect the company's commercial position.
  • Manage notices, extensions of time, loss and expense claims, and contractual correspondence where required.
  • Build and maintain strong working relationships with clients, main contractors, consultants, and supply chain partners.
  • Attend project meetings and provide commercial support to operational teams.
  • Work collaboratively with site teams to ensure commercial and operational objectives are aligned.
  • Present project performance updates and financial forecasts.
  • Provide strategic commercial input to support business planning and growth.
